SelectedIndexChanged 事件触发后的关联操作指引

SelectedIndexChanged 事件是 .NET 控件(如 ListBox、ComboBox 和 RadioButtonList)中一个重要的事件,用于在用户更改所选索引时触发。该事件提供了多种关联操作的选项,包括数据绑定、命令执行和页面导航。本指南将详细介绍 SelectedIndexChanged 事件触发后的关联操作指引,涵盖六个主要方面。

数据绑定

SelectedIndexChanged 事件可用于触发数据绑定操作,从而将所选索引与数据源中的特定项相关联。通过在事件处理程序中使用索引值,可以检索数据源中的对应项并将其绑定到其他控件或对象中。这个关联可以显示所选项目的详细信息、更新数据库或执行其他基于数据的操作。

命令执行

SelectedIndexChanged 事件还可以触发命令执行。通过将事件处理程序与 CommandName 或 CommandArgument 属性关联,可以执行用户界面中定义的命令。这个关联允许在用户更改所选索引时触发特定操作,例如提交表单、导航到另一个页面或调用自定义方法。

页面导航

selectedindexchanged(SelectedIndexChanged 事件触发后的关联操作指引)

对于 Web 应用程序,SelectedIndexChanged 事件可用于触发页面导航。通过设置控件的 NavigateUrl 属性,可以将所选索引映射到特定页面 URL。这个关联支持基于用户选择动态加载页面,例如根据选定的类别或产品展示不同的内容。

状态管理

SelectedIndexChanged 事件可用于管理应用程序的状态。通过在事件处理程序中存储所选索引,可以保存用户偏好或跟踪应用程序的状态。这个关联有助于在用户返回页面或应用程序时保持当前所选索引,从而提供无缝的用户体验。

UI 更新

SelectedIndexChanged 事件可用于更新用户界面。通过在事件处理程序中修改其他控件的属性,可以根据所选索引动态更改外观或行为。这个关联允许创建交互式用户界面,其中元素会根据用户选择而自动调整,增强用户体验。

事件处理

处理 SelectedIndexChanged 事件需要遵循特定的步骤。需要在控件上添加事件处理程序。接下来,需要使用代码逻辑来实现所需的关联操作,例如数据绑定、命令执行或页面导航。确保事件处理程序能够正确处理异常,并提供适当的反馈给用户。

SelectedIndexChanged 事件在 .NET 控件中提供了一个强大的机制,用于触发各种关联操作。通过理解和应用本文所述的指引,开发人员可以充分利用此事件来增强应用程序的交互性和功能性。

特别提醒:本网信息来自于互联网,目的在于传递更多信息,并不代表本网赞同其观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,并请自行核实相关内容。本站不承担此类作品侵权行为的直接责任及连带责任。如若本网有任何内容侵犯您的权益,请及时联系我们,本站将会在24小时内处理完毕。